Output 3327abb8befc68a09abe50f8536cfad90f683183847c53cedb21a614ba016586:0

value
500000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3445d83ddcfd4f65f1d0ce80df71b14b7557545f OP_EQUAL
address
36TQjQvky5tu9PQWcAS5iVBbXVgeKF3qdq
transaction
3327abb8befc68a09abe50f8536cfad90f683183847c53cedb21a614ba016586
spent
true